Participating in an international youth exchange program like the SayPro Southern Africa Youth Project Erasmus+ Ghana Travel is far more than just a travel opportunity—it is a life-changing experience that contributes profoundly to personal growth and development. These exchanges expose young people to new cultures, perspectives, and challenges that build critical life skills and inspire a greater sense of purpose and global citizenship.
Here are the key personal development benefits young participants gain from international youth exchanges:
1. Enhanced Confidence and Independence
Leaving one’s home country to engage with a different environment requires courage and adaptability. From navigating airports to participating in group activities with international peers, youth quickly develop greater self-confidence and the ability to operate independently.
✔️ Benefit: Youth return home with stronger problem-solving skills and self-assurance in unfamiliar situations.
2. Cross-Cultural Awareness and Empathy
Experiencing Ghana’s rich cultural traditions, from local etiquette to storytelling and music, helps participants develop intercultural sensitivity. They learn to appreciate diversity, respect different worldviews, and communicate effectively across cultural boundaries.
✔️ Benefit: Cultivates emotional intelligence and empathy—skills essential for future leaders in a globalized world.
3. Improved Communication and Language Skills
Whether through English, local languages like Twi, or non-verbal cues, youth in exchange programs sharpen their communication skills. They learn to listen actively, express themselves clearly, and adapt to different communication styles.
✔️ Benefit: Boosts verbal and non-verbal communication, essential for both academic and career success.
4. Leadership and Teamwork Development
SayPro encourages youth to take part in collaborative projects and discussions during the exchange. Whether leading a workshop, co-hosting a cultural event, or resolving group conflicts, participants build their leadership capacity and learn the value of teamwork.
✔️ Benefit: Develops initiative, responsibility, and the ability to work effectively with others.
5. Personal Reflection and Goal Setting
Living and learning in a new context encourages deep self-reflection. Through daily journaling, group debriefs, and cultural immersion, youth reassess their values, goals, and aspirations.
✔️ Benefit: Clarifies personal purpose and inspires long-term ambitions in education, activism, or entrepreneurship.
6. Expanded Global Networks and Friendships
Youth exchanges create lifelong bonds. Meeting peers from different regions fosters lasting friendships and opens doors to regional and international collaboration.
✔️ Benefit: Builds a supportive network of changemakers across Africa and beyond.
